The en dash (–), a hyphen with a growth spurt, is used to represent the words “to” or “through” when specifying a range. Linking these words with hyphens is necessary so that the reader understands they should be taken together as a descriptor. The most common usage of an en dash is to replace the words “to” or “through” when indicating a range of values, such as a span of time, dates or numbers. The differences might appear subtle, but their usages are distinct: The hyphen (-), the shortest, is used to join multiple words that function together as a single concept, a.k.a. Same sequence but search for en-dash on the other character. To insert an em dash (—), click on … Like the hyphen, there should never be a space between the en dash and its adjacent content. It can also set off pauses or interruptions within a text—like parentheses, except with a more emphatic effect that still maintains the natural flow of discourse.
